Former MotoGP Rider Capirossi Praises BIC Track Ahead of Indian GP

Former MotoGP™️ star Loris Capirossi expressed his contentment with the quality of the race track at the Buddh International Circuit and shared his predictions for the inaugural IndianOil Grand Prix of India, scheduled to take place from September 22 to 24. As a safety advisor to Dorna Sports, the organizer of the MotoGP™️ World Championship, Capirossi had the opportunity to ride the circuit and was pleased with its layout.

He is eager to witness the competitive race among the top MotoGP™️ riders from around the world. Capirossi mentioned that the track has fast corners and well-defined breaking points that will add excitement to the event. The IndianOil Grand Prix of India, organized by FairStreet Sports in collaboration with Dorna Sports, will feature 82 riders from 41 teams competing in the MotoGP™️, Moto 2, and Moto 3 categories over three days.

Capirossi also disclosed his favourites to win the IndianOil Grand Prix, including Marco Bezzecchi, Jorge Martin, and Brad Binder. However, he noted that Francesco Bagnaia, despite his potential, may not be in top form due to a recent crash. Capirossi highlighted the significance of the track’s unique features, particularly the turns from four to seven and the exciting parabolic section.

Since this is the first time MotoGP™️ riders will experience racing in India, Capirossi expressed his enthusiasm for the event. The highly anticipated IndianOil Grand Prix of India will be exclusively broadcast on Sports18 and streamed live on JioCinema in India.
